walley tags aren't working
 
Tried to buy my B walleye license today but the message says invalid tag numbers. I just got these 20 tags mailed to me a week ago. None worked. I looked through my fishing drawer and found 2 unused tags from last year. They work. I bet there's lots of people on here who couldn't buy their walleye tags today because of these recently made tags. Anyone else have this issue?

Phone the Alberta Relm help number and give them the tag numbers, they will activate your new tags. Some tags get sent out and the person doing it forgets to activate them. Happens with hunting tags too. Easy fix.

They are blank tags, just like blank hunting tags, you can order as many as you want. I get a good batch when I order too, that way they last me 3 or 4 years before I have to order more.

E-tags have been paused for this year. Only paper tags. I found that you have to include the preceding zeros when registering the tags to the license. Didn’t work when I didn’t include them.

You can also purchase the tags at any Fishing Hole location and they will register the tag numbers for you. That is what I did for my A class and then I picked up B class for Pigeon as well since there are so many left.

I imagine by mid-July they may just release all the tags and we should be able to pick up more. Since slots are still in play and they went back to paper tags (ugh!), the uptake has dropped off. No surprise.
